The Science Behind Our Residential Water Extraction Process
Our team follows a strict process to ensure that every drop of water is removed and your property is restored to its original condition. We start by containing the affected area to prevent further damage and then use specialized equipment to extract the water. Our technicians then dry the area using advanced drying protocols and monitor moisture levels to ensure that everything is completely dry.
Step 1: Containment
We use specialized equipment to contain the affected area and prevent further damage. This includes sealing off affected rooms and setting up drying equipment.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use powerful pumps and vacuum equipment to extract as much water as possible from the affected area. This is typically done within 60 minutes of arrival.
Step 3: Drying
We use advanced drying protocols to dry the affected area, including the use of desiccants and dehumidifiers. Our technicians monitor moisture levels to ensure that everything is completely dry.
Step 4: Monitoring
We continue to monitor the affected area to ensure that everything is completely dry and there are no further issues. This includes taking moisture readings and checking for any signs of further damage.
Step 5: Restoration
Once the area is completely dry, our team can begin the restoration process. This may include repairing or replacing damaged materials, such as drywall or flooring.

Warning Signs You Need Residential Water Extraction
Catching water dam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ent further problems. Here are some warning signs that you need residential water extraction: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can be a sign of water damage. If you notice a musty smell that persists, it’s time to call our team.
Water Stains on the Ceiling
Water stains on the ceiling can be a sign of a leak or burst pipe.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age. If you notice this issue, call our team immediately.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age. This can lead to further issues, such as mold growth and structural damage.
Unusual Noises
Unusual noises, such as dripping or gurgling sounds, can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to further problems.
Mold or Mildew Growth
Mold or mildew growth can be a sign of water damage. This can lead to serious health issues and further damage to your property.

Residential Water Extraction Cost In Warren, MI
The cost of residential water extraction in Warren, MI var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imates for common scenarios: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Small leak under the sink | $500 – $1,000 | Size of affected area and complexity of repair |
| Large flood in the basement | $2,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ials damaged, and complexity of repair |
| Water damage from a burst pipe |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ials damaged, and complexity of repair |
| Water stains on the ceiling |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and complexity of repair |
| Mold or mildew growth |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of affected area and complexity of removal |
